我是Linux用户,但我需要使用IE11运行我的Robot Framework测试。我用Win7 + IE11设置了Virtual Box。我设置系统并在那里运行以下测试:
*** Settings ***
Library Selenium2Library
*** Test Cases ***
Run a browser
Open Browser http://www.google.com ie None http://192.168.56.101:4444/wd/hub
现在,在虚拟机中,IE已打开,并且www.google.com页面已打开。所以这个简单的测试工作正常。
我只是想知道,在虚拟机中运行实际测试的最佳方法是什么。我有很多测试。我可以通过启动命令以某种方式以某种方式将地址http://192.168.56.101:4444/wd/hub提供给命令行吗?
或者我是否需要制作特殊关键字来检查,如何开始测试。
有什么建议吗?你是如何解决这个问题的?
答案 0 :(得分:0)
使用机器人框架时,可以使用适当的参数在命令行中声明此信息。这方面的一个例子可以格式化为:
机器人 - 包含smoke - 变量主机:[host_IP]路径/到/ tests /
此信息可在此处找到更多详细信息: http://robotframework.org/robotframework/latest/RobotFrameworkUserGuide.html#id142